The Ranch at Laguna Beach Golf Course
Carved into the storied Aliso Canyon, right in the heart of Orange County, resides The Ranch at Laguna Beach. Laguna’s first homestead and tribal meeting place is now home base to Laguna Beach’s only golf course, Harvest signature restaurant, Lost Pier Cafe, Sycamore Spa and 97 guestrooms & suites. The People’s Council
The People’s Council Linda Brunker , 2006 Three carved granite figures representing everyman, everywoman and youth, sit surrounding an inlaid granite disk with a black polished obelisk in the center. As the sun moves, the obelisk casts a shadow like a sundial on words representing the aspirations of the community.
